Rosella Kretzschmer

March 25, 1918 — October 7, 2014

Rosella E. Kretzschmer, 96, of Owendale, died Tuesday, October 7, 2014 in Northwood Meadows, Cass City. She was born March 25, 1918 in Grant Township, Cass City to Roy and Florence (Duffield) Powell. She married William Fredrick Kretzschmer, Sr. June 17, 1938 at his family home in Owendale. He died October 4, 1985.

Rosella graduated from Owendale High School in 1936. She worked as a teacher's aide in Owen-Gage Elementary School. Rosella enjoyed oil painting, crocheting, knitting and sewing, making many beautiful quilts and restoring old dolls to their original beauty. Rosella lived her life for Christ. She enjoyed playing piano in the Owendale United Methodist Church. Later, Rosella became an active member of the Cass City First Baptist Church.
